Hello Guys
I do a lot of post driving with older tractors (a Massey 165 and Leyland 344 - oh dear, now there a fine piece of crap for you).
I have a hydraulic top link but have never fitted it because the systems on these older tractors means you have to "switch" between the 3pt and externals. Now I've just done a marathon post session and feel like I've arm wrestled the californian governor from winding on the top link !!
Is there a manual pump (and valve to switch direction) I could rig to use the top link - maybe a Enerpac or something ??
Cheers - Foster
